2011 Hyundai Lease Rates – October 2010

logo_hyundaiUpdate: Tucson and Genesis numbers added. Sonata Limited residual updated.

My Take: Numbers look like they have changed a little bit for the Sonata this month. MF got a bump, but so did the residual (which is odd but not unheard of). It is not uncommon to see residuals increase on occasion since the resale value of cars can go up depending on their popularity. The new rates did not change the payments much (less than $1 increase in the monthly payments) so the Sonata remains a good value.

2011 Hyundai Sonata SE
36-month | 15k miles | residual 55% | .00047 base money factor

2011 Hyundai Sonata GLS
36-month | 15k miles | residual 55% | .00068 base money factor

2011 Hyundai Sonata Limited
36-month | 15k miles | residual 56% | .00068 base money factor

2011 Genesis Coupe 3.8
36-month | 15k miles | residual 55% | .00150 base money factor

2011 Genesis Coupe 3.8 GT
36-month | 15k miles | residual 56% | .00150 base money factor

2011 Tucson Limited 4WD
36-month | 15k miles | residual 58% | .00230 base money factor
